A Castletown MHK says he is uncomfortable about government’s decision to bail out the Sefton Group.
Richard Ronan says he’s already been approached by other businesses in his constituency who think it’s unfair.
He says there are other people who are also struggling who are questioning if this is a new interventionist policy.
Mr Ronan says it is important to support Manx business but feels that the assistance package should have been more widely considered:
